EQUITY BANK UNVEILS EQUITY ONLINE FOR BUSINESS

Equity Bank Uganda has launched a new digital banking platform named “Equity Online for Business

The launch is aimed at enhancing efficiency, security, and real-time financial management for enterprises of all sizes.

The new platform is a total rebuild designed to replace the previous EazzyBiz system.

The bank said all business clients must immediately transition to the new platform to continue accessing its digital services.

Executive Director Claver Serumaga explained that the upgrade is designed to meet the growing demand for fast, integrated financial information in today’s business environment.

“The new system brings multiple services into one place, allowing companies to handle payroll, supplier payments, and foreign exchange transactions on a single platform. It can be accessed via web browsers, a mobile app, and APIs that connect directly to a company’s accounting systems,’he stated.

According to Serumaga,  key improvements are real-time tracking of funds across different currencies and automated transfers that help businesses manage excess balances more efficiently. Companies can also manage their own accounts internally, including assigning user roles and permissions, without having to rely on the bank.

On security, the platform uses multiple layers of protection such as one-time passwords and token-based verification. It also includes audit trails and dashboards that help businesses monitor transactions, reduce errors, and detect potential financial leakages.

Serumaga said the goal is to move beyond basic banking and offer businesses a complete financial management tool that supports faster and better decision-making.

Key Features

It allows businesses to manage payroll, supplier payments, recurring bills, and foreign transactions in a single, secure interface.

It offers real-time tracking for all money received and paid out.

he Bank of Uganda’s executive director for national payment systems, Dr. Twinemanzi Tumwebeine, praised the new platform as a “major step beyond conventional online banking

Equity Bank Uganda Limited is a fast-growing commercial bank licensed by the Bank of Uganda, serving over 2 million customers with 50+ branches, extensive agent banking (Equi Duuka), and robust digital channels. As a subsidiary of Kenya-based Equity Group Holdings, it offers comprehensive retail and corporate banking,.
